TNB Renewables
TNB Renewables is a wholly-owned subsidiary of Malaysia's national utility, Tenaga Nasional Berhad (TNB), focused on developing, owning, and operating renewable energy assets. The company aims to expand its domestic and international renewable energy portfolio, primarily in solar, wind, and hydro, to support TNB Group's sustainability goals and Net Zero Emissions aspirations.

Strategic Overview
- Aims to be a leading renewable energy player in ASEAN and beyond, leveraging its parent company's strong utility background.
- Focuses on expanding its international portfolio, particularly in developed markets with stable regulatory frameworks and attractive renewable energy growth potential.
- Committed to supporting TNB Group's Net Zero Emissions aspirations by 2050 through aggressive renewable energy capacity growth.
